Ostel

Travel back in time to former East Germany at the Ostel hotel in central Berlin.

Our guesthouse in the “Berlin Mitte” district offers you a unique experience. Travel with us back to the former East Germany, the GDR, starting with the original GDR furniture to a city tour in a Trabant vehicle.

    My girlfriend is actually born in former East Germany and recognizes A LOT of the interior design from the Ostel hotel. They didn't have much to choose from back in the old East German days. It was a very, very limited set of furniture you had to choose from. If you wanted a bed, you could pick Bed1 or Bed2. If you wanted a kitchen table, you could pick Table1 or Table2 - more or less.

    Believe or not, they had to queue for at least 10 years to get a Trabant. When they finally had the chance to get one of those cardboard cars, the wall came down. :)
